> Wayne Campbell wrote:
> > Thanks, Robert. That's done, so now how do I access my harddisk image? I
> > did a mdir and see that /h0 and emudsk are not there. I'm guessing this
> > means I have to build a custom boot?
> >
> 
> Wayne,
> 
> Yes, unfortunately there probably aren't many default .vhds for mounting on VCC which will access 
> DW4 disks nor disks for DW4 that once booted have access to the default VCC hard drives. So, you 
> will need to build a custom boot file for best/safest access to both DW drives and VCC hard drives.
> 
> There is one other thing you can try which may work but is not the best approach. :) You can merge 
> emudsk and h0 into a single file in your CMDS directory. Set the merged file for execution ex.
> attr VCCvhd e pe
> and after booting from the DW4 disk, load the merged file however it is named.
> You should then be able to read the OS-9 partition of the .vhd mounted on VCC.
> 
> Now EmuDsk and H0 will not be on the nightly build Becker disk. You will need to get those from your 
> VCC .vhd or I can send them to you. The merged file will need to be transferred to the DW4 boot disk.
